Coca-Cola is scrapping two of its sugar-free products, replacing them with a single flavour. Coke Zero and Coke No Sugar will be phased out from next month, with Coke Zero Sugar taking their place. Coca-Cola New Zealand head of marketing Tracey Evans said the Coke Zero Sugar recipe aimed to create a taste as close to the original Coca-Cola as possible.
